President Trump reportedly called Johnson late last week to urge him not to allow Huawei in Britain’s 5G plans. Johnson hinted Monday that he would seek a compromise plan that would allow Huawei into British 5G systems with some as-yet-unspecified restrictions that are meant to placate Washington. “The economic arguments in favor of Huawei fall apart when the costs of risk mitigation are included,” they wrote.
